Improving Requirements Development Efficiency and Quality with Decision Aids
Abstract
For the past two years, the U.S. Army Program Executive Office for Simulation, Training and Instrumentation (PEOSTRI) has researched, developed, and is currently implementing an approach for managing project requirements. PEOSTRI began by establishing the Requirements Management Working Group (RMWG), an experienced oversight team of requirements engineering subject matter experts (SMEs) and enterprise architects. The RMWG is chartered to facilitate and promote strategic reuse of requirements management assets. In 2020, the RMWG is developing a requirements decision aid, the Requirements Management Process Model (RMPM). The RMPM will assist projects with adopting and adapting enterprise assets-processes, tools, templates, and training materials. This paper describes the RMWGs process for creating the RMPM and how it will be used to identify PEO STRI enterprise assets appropriate to a given project. It defines the relationship between RMPM processes and project management approaches, and presents the planned path forward for prototyping this aid with PEO STRI program managers.
